Students with an artistic background have a wide range of professional alternatives. While performing arts provide options in acting, dancing, directing, and producing, visual arts and design offer pathways like graphic design, illustration, and art direction. Digital marketing experts, social media managers, and content producers are common positions in the field of digital media and communication.
Options for authorship, content development, and journalism are presented by writing and journalism. Furthermore, curators of galleries or museums are included in the field of arts administration. An arts degree's adaptability enables people to work in a variety of sectors, bringing creativity and critical thinking to disciplines like media and entertainment, design, and administration.
